【问题标题】:Prevent Bootstrap Menu going Behind Footer防止引导菜单落后于页脚
【发布时间】:2020-09-16 01:44:33
【问题描述】:

我设计了一个具有顶部导航、滑块和页脚的页面。它在桌面上看起来不错,但是当我们在移动设备上打开/展开菜单时,菜单在页脚后面。

请注意,我们无法在 Slider 和 Footer 之间添加额外的空格来防止这种情况,如 this 中所述

以下是移动设备的屏幕截图:

我们如何解决这个问题? 请帮忙

谢谢

【问题讨论】:

    标签: html css twitter-bootstrap web twitter-bootstrap-3


    【解决方案1】:

    在 CSS 中增加下拉菜单的 z-index。就像你的下拉菜单是这样的:

    <div class="dropdown">
      <ul>
        <li><a>Home</a></li>
        <li><a>About Us</a></li>
      </ul>
    </div>
    

    您只需确保下拉列表的 z-index 大于您的页脚元素。您可以尝试增加下拉元素的 z-index,如下所示:

    .dropdown {
        z-index: 999
     }
    

    确保您的下拉列表具有静态以外的位置以使 z-index 生效,并且您为其提供的 z-index 值应大于页脚元素的 z-index 值。

    【讨论】:

      猜你喜欢
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 2014-05-28
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 2021-05-28
      相关资源
      最近更新 更多